Renowned gamer and YouTube personality Dr Disrespect has recently shown his admiration for the latest addition to theStar Warsgaming universe,Star Wars Jedi: Survivor. The game has been highly anticipated by the community, and its predecessor’s warm reception only increased the excitement around its release. However, there appear to be some issues with the new release, with theStar Wars Jedi: Survivorfacing a wave of negative reviewsand criticism from the community.Fans have taken to online digital storefronts and sites like Metacritic to hit the game with a wave of low scores and negative comments. Many reviews suggest that the game’s performance on PC is the primary issue, with several players experiencing problems even with high-end graphic cards. Astatement was also released by the official EA Star Wars Twitter account on April 28th, acknowledging performance issues that have been reported in the PC version ofStar Wars Jedi: Survivor. According to the statement, EA and Respawn are aware that players may experience technical issues on high-end PCs with certain configurations, particularly those with multithreaded chipsets designed for Windows 11 and high-end graphics cards paired with lower-end CPUs. The development team has apologized for any inconvenience caused to PC gamers by these performance issues and is working on several performance fixes to address them.
However, the statement also notes that these performance fixes require thorough testing to ensure that they do not introduce new problems into the PC version of the game. As a result, the development team has not yet announced a specific timeline for these updates but will do so as soon as they are ready.
Star Wars Jedi: Survivoris currently available on PC,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X/S.
